THIS EVENING
Mostly cloudy skies tonight with just an isolated sprinkle or flurry otherwise expect dry conditions. Winds will be light to calm. Temperatures won’t feel too bad in the low 30s. They will slowly drop to the upper 20s but the clouds keep them from getting too cold tonight.

Highs will be early in the low to mid 30s. Winds will shift from the west to the northwest and pick up by afternoon 15 to 20 mph with gusts to 30 but in the evening the gusts become stronger. By 6pm we could see temperatures in the mid 20s with teens by 10pm. Factor in the winds and wind chills are likely to be running below zero by late evening. High pressure builds in to clear the skies out setting the stage for the coldest day of the winter season, in fact, the coldest day since last January 28th when we hit 15.

Temperatures Sunday will bottom out in the single digits and only climb to the low to mid teens by afternoon. Of course factor in the winds, it will feel like it’s below zero. It will be a great weekend to stay warm inside and watch a good movie or read a great book. Sunday night into Monday morning will be the coldest by far and could come close to tying or breaking the morning low of 0 set in 1904 and 1905. Either way prepare for a very, very cold morning. Highs should reach near 20 by afternoon under mostly sunny skies. Our next system comes in from the south and may bring a wintry mix. Temperatures will continue to run well below average through Wednesday.
